What does high-maintenance mean?
High-maintenance means (of a system) Requiring a high degree of maintenance to ensure proper functioning, and without which it is likely to break down..

Pronunciation varies by accent · adjective
(of a system) Requiring a high degree of maintenance to ensure proper functioning, and without which it is likely to break down..
He has this incredibly high-maintenance girlfriend; if he doesn't tell her that he loves her every five minutes, she tends to break down into hysterical depressive weepy fits.
There are two kinds of women: high maintenance and low maintenance.
